The La Liga relegation battle enters its final two matchdays in unprecedented chaos, with nine to twelve clubs separated by just six points from eighth-placed Real Sociedad down to 19th-placed Girona, meaning 42 points could prove the survival threshold. Recent results have kept the fight alive, including Alavés climbing out of the drop zone via a win over Barcelona and Espanyol’s dramatic late victory that reignited their hopes alongside Valencia, Osasuna, and Rayo Vallecano. Clubs such as Sevilla, Athletic Club, and Mallorca must navigate tough remaining fixtures while avoiding slips that could see them overtaken by Levante or Elche, who sit just behind on the table. This compressed points spread leaves even mid-table sides with European ambitions still mathematically vulnerable, amplifying the impact of every result on final standings.
